Design and Management Plan of a Village Pond for Multiple use in Eastern Coastal Zone of India in Odisha

A study was undertaken in a pond, named Digi pokhari, in Garadpur village (Latitude 20° 23′ 1″ N and Longitude 86° 22′ 2″ E) situated under Garadpur block of Kendrapada district in south-eastern coastal plain zone of Odisha, India. The historical hydrological data were analyzed to find out the period in which the standard week wise rainfall is more than evaporation to store excess water in the pond. The pond was targeted for multiple use of water such as domestic, irrigation of crop as well as fishery, etc. The total inflow of water into the pond as well as peak rate of runoff was estimated. Different structures such as trapping mesh, sediment basin and gabion filters were designed for the pond to maintain the quality of water inflow into the pond. The design dimensions of the sediment basin with 40 m length, 1.5 m deep below the existing channel bottom with a trapezoidal shape of 4 m top width at the bottom of the existing channel which should be reduced to a bottom width of 2 m with 1 horizontal: 1.5 vertical side slope is recommended. It was found that with the recommended design, desilting of the sediment basin is required to be done once after two years. With the recommended design prescriptions of different structures required in a pond, it can be recommended that the similar approach can be taken up in different ponds located in south-eastern coastal plain zone of Odisha. The pond water can be used for multiple use including, domestic, irrigation and fishery activities.
